Transition to Ecological and Democratic Societies Using 100% Renewable Community Power

Abstract:

Transition of communities, islands, countries and regions to 100% Renewable Energy (RE) can be realized only by the local, national and regional governments which are on the solution side. The green solution in the energy field is the achievement of 100% renewable energy target by the integration of the energy end-use efficiency, smart grids and storage of the renewable energy using the best available technologies Energy-Economy-Ecology decision making models and Internalization of Externalities are required to plan the future energy systems with the technologies of the future and to eliminate the dislocation of obsolete technologies from one market to another in our global living space.

Biographical Sketch

Dr. Uyar has been a Professor of Renewable Energy at Marmara University since 2001, where he heads the Energy Section of Faculty of Engineering. He also serves as President of Eurosolar Turkey and Conference Chair of IRENEC 2016. From 1994-2001, he was an Assistant Professor at Kocaeli University Faculty of Technical Education Department of Electrical Education. Previous professional experience includes being a Senior Research Scientist  serving as a member of the Energy Systems Research Department  at TUBITAK, Scientific and Technical Research Council of Turkey,Marmara  Scientific and Industrial Research Institute, and holding the position of Director of the Chamber of Electrical Engineers Istanbul Branch from 1976-1978. He completed his formal education in Istanbul, Turkey, receiving his BSc and MSc (the latter in Nuclear Engineering) from Boğaziçi University, Faculty of Engineering, Department of Electrical Engineering. He received his PhD from Yıldız Technical University, Mechanical Engineering Department. Dr. Uyar also serves as Vice President of the World Wind Energy Association, Board Member of the International Solar Energy Society, Board member of the World Bioenergy Association, and Member of the World Council for Renewable Energy.
